A Maple Park couple has been charged with endangering the life of a child after dropping their two children off in a Geneva neighborhood in subzero windchills while the parents were not immediately available, Geneva police said.

The charges allege the parents — Johnathan Meegan, 37, and Karen Meegan, 36, of the 40W000 block of Route 38, Maple Park — left their children, both under the age of 14, in an unfamiliar neighborhood at 5:30 p.m. Jan. 1 when the temperature was 9 degrees and the windchill was 3 degrees below zero. There was no shelter or means of contacting the parents for assistance for more than 15 minutes, police said. The charges are a misdemeanor.

The Meegans also each were issued warning notices for violation of Geneva's solicitation ordinance, police said.

Geneva police Cmdr. Julie Nash said the state Department of Children and Family Services was notified.
